Development Engineer (m/w/d) FPGA and Embedded Systems
Your Responsibilities and Duties
- You are involved in the continuous development of the existing product portfolio by introducing new concepts, ideas and technologies
- You are responsible for the design, conception and implementation of complex functions in the FPGA to extend and improve the signal processing in our products
- You contribute to the design of a unified architecture and system strategy for our products
- You take over tasks of simulation, verification and validation of the FPGA design on module-, top-level and system level
- You create and maintain the documentation of the FPGA firmware.
Your Skills and Qualifications
- You have a degree in electrical engineering or information technology (or a comparable qualification)
- You have relevant experience in developing digital signal processing applications with VHDL/Verilog on FPGAs (ideally Xilinx Zynq SoCs)
- You have experience with modern scripting languages like Python or LUA
- You are familiar with version management via Git and have knowledge of continuous integration and automated testing
- You are able to work in a team and to communicate in German and English and you bring along initiative and future-oriented thinking
